a)What are polyatomic ions? Give one example each of polyatomic cation and anion.
b) What do you understand from the statement “relative atomic mass of sulphur is 32”?
c) What is meant by the term ‘chemical formula’?

a) A group of atoms carrying a charge is known as polyatomic ion, example of polyatomic cation: NH4+and polyatomic anion: NO3-.
b) It means an atom of sulphur is 32 times heavier than 1/12th the mass of 1 Carbon-12 atom.
c) Chemical formula represents the composition of a molecule of the substance in terms of the symbols of the elements present in the molecule.
